Orestes of Macedon

 
Wikipedia: Orestes of Macedon

Orestes of Macedon (Greek: Ὀρέστης ὁ Μακεδών) was son of Archelaus and successor king of his murdered father. He reigned between 399-396 BC along with his guardian Aeropus II.
